The already troubled trial of Saddam Hussein descended into chaos yesterday as a new head judge's attempt to assert his authority sparked a walk-out by the former Iraqi president and his defence team and the forcible removal of another defendant.
The courtroom theatrics were unusual even by the disorderly standards of the case, which opened in October. The incidents, together with the resignation of the previous lead judge two weeks ago, are likely to polarise Iraqis further.
